Company Overview

DoubleVerify Holdings, Inc. is a software platform company focused on digital media measurement, advertising verification, and campaign optimization. The company operates within the digital advertising, ad-tech, cybersecurity, and media analytics industries, providing tools that help advertisers, agencies, publishers, and advertising platforms measure the quality and effectiveness of digital advertising campaigns. Its core offerings are designed to verify ad viewability, detect ad fraud and invalid traffic, ensure brand safety and suitability, and optimize advertising performance across desktop, mobile, connected television (CTV), social media, and emerging digital channels.

The company’s primary revenue drivers are software and analytics services sold to enterprise advertisers, advertising agencies, demand-side platforms, and publishers through subscription-based and usage-based arrangements. DoubleVerify positions itself as an independent verification provider with integrations across major digital advertising ecosystems, including large social media and streaming platforms. Founded in 2008, the company expanded through product development, acquisitions, and international market growth before becoming publicly traded on the New York Stock Exchange in 2021 under the ticker DV. Public disclosures and industry reporting consistently identify the company as a major participant in the global digital advertising verification market.

Business Operations

DoubleVerify organizes its operations around digital media measurement and verification solutions that support advertisers and publishers throughout the advertising transaction lifecycle. Its principal business capabilities include media quality verification, fraud detection, brand suitability measurement, contextual targeting, campaign performance analytics, and attention measurement. Revenue is primarily generated through software platform usage tied to advertising impression volumes and enterprise customer contracts. The company serves customers across open web, social media, mobile applications, streaming environments, and connected TV platforms.

The company maintains operations across both domestic and international markets, with customers in North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Latin America, and the Middle East. Its technology stack includes proprietary artificial intelligence, machine learning, and large-scale data analytics systems designed to process advertising impressions in real time. Strategic integrations with major advertising platforms and media ecosystems form a key operational component of the business. Public filings identify subsidiaries and acquired assets including OpenSlate, which expanded the company’s capabilities in social media and video content suitability measurement.

Strategic Position & Investments

DoubleVerify has emphasized expansion into high-growth digital advertising channels including connected television, retail media networks, social media advertising, and AI-enabled campaign optimization. Its strategy centers on increasing measurement coverage across fragmented advertising environments while improving advertiser transparency and return on ad spend. The company has invested heavily in proprietary data infrastructure, automation capabilities, and cross-platform verification technology to support global advertisers navigating increasingly complex digital ecosystems.

A notable strategic acquisition was OpenSlate, acquired to strengthen social content classification and brand suitability capabilities, particularly across video-sharing and creator-driven platforms. The company has also expanded partnerships with major technology and media platforms to deepen integrations for measurement and campaign analytics. Public disclosures and investor materials indicate continued investment in attention metrics, performance measurement tools, and AI-driven media optimization technologies. The company’s strategic positioning is frequently associated with rising advertiser demand for transparency, fraud prevention, and independent media verification standards.

Geographic Footprint

DoubleVerify is headquartered in New York, United States, and maintains a broad international operating presence across major advertising markets. The company serves customers throughout North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Latin America, and the Middle East, with offices and commercial operations supporting multinational advertisers and agencies. Its customer base includes global consumer brands, media agencies, advertising platforms, and publishers operating across multiple continents.

The company’s international footprint has expanded alongside global digital advertising spending and the growth of connected television and social media advertising. Regulatory developments related to privacy, data protection, and advertising transparency in regions such as the European Union and parts of Asia-Pacific have influenced the company’s product development and compliance capabilities. Public filings and investor communications indicate that international revenue represents a meaningful component of overall business activity, though North America remains its largest market.

Leadership & Governance

DoubleVerify was co-founded by Oren Netzer and Alex Yazdani. The company’s leadership has consistently emphasized independent verification, scalable technology infrastructure, and cross-platform advertising transparency as core strategic priorities. Governance oversight is conducted through a publicly listed corporate structure following the company’s NYSE listing, with disclosures made through SEC filings, annual reports, and investor presentations.

Key executives include:

  • Mark Zagorski – Chief Executive Officer
  • Nicola T. Allais – Chief Financial Officer
  • Jack Marshall – Chief Operating Officer
  • Steven Woolway – Executive Vice President, Business Development
  • Julie Eddleman – Chief People Officer
  • David Goddard – Chief Strategy Officer

The leadership team has focused on expanding global market penetration, strengthening advertiser relationships, and increasing technological differentiation in media verification and measurement services. Public company disclosures emphasize operational scalability, strategic acquisitions, and continued investment in AI-enabled analytics as central components of management’s long-term strategy.
